THE BROWNIES WERE GREAT
I finished my week of teaching the math class. It was an awesome experience! By the end of the week:
• I had about 15 students joining me for lunch.
•Six separate students were bringing their Rubik's Cubes to class.
•I brought candy and I baked cookies, cake, and brownies for my beloved students. I got up at 7am on Friday to bake the brownies.
•I got a cd of music from one of my favorites, John Collector.
•Multiple students told me I should stay and their teacher should not come back.
•One student was amazed because he said he never does work and he did homework every day while I was there.
•I taught how to solve a power function, Y=ax^b that passes through the points (1,6) and (12,5) and how to graph a Logistic Growth Function.

THE FIRST TIME'S THE HARDEST
Whoo! What a day! I had an interesting time subbing for my math class. Interesting, but good. Basically, I feel really bad for the first class that I teach, because I make all of my big mistakes with them, and then get better as the day goes on.
Like this morning, when I became totally flustered because I wasn't sure what the book was trying to say, and so I started to teach the math wrong. Fortunately the class was a very forgiving one, not to mention quite bright.
I was smooth and cool by sixth period, though!
Haha, tomorrow will be phenomenal. I promise.

THE RUBBER BANDS
Yesterday in the math class that I substituted for, three Seniors at Dos Pueblos found a very large bag of rubber bands. They were the teacher's rubber bands, but that wasn't stopping anybody. The guys were using them to shoot small pieces of paper at each other. I took the rubber bands away and said that I wouldn't write their names down unless I saw them messing around again.
I'm supposed to be the 'nice' sub!
About five minutes later, out of my periphery I see a rubber band held low and a paper flying towards someone's back.
Their names were recorded. In black ink.
And just in case you were wondering what kind of math it was that these sophomores, juniors, and seniors were doing, here is a sample question from their work:
-1 - (9)= ?
also:
Two lines are on a graph. Without using a calculator or drawing a graph, find out where the lines intersect:
y=1/3X+5
y=x-3
